Types of Sedation Options



When it pertains to selecting the ideal sedation option for your oral treatment, you'll locate numerous methods customized to different requirements and choices. One of the most usual kinds are laughing gas, dental sedation, and IV sedation.

Nitrous oxide, likewise known as chuckling gas, is a preferred option for numerous individuals. It's breathed in with a mask, supplying a calming impact while allowing you to continue to be awake and receptive. The results wear away rapidly, so you can drive yourself home afterward.

IV sedation uses much deeper relaxation and enables your dental expert to adjust the sedation level throughout the treatment. This technique is ideal for longer or more complicated therapies. You'll likely be in a semi-conscious state and will certainly require someone to drive you home later.

Each option has its advantages, so discussing your preferences and worry about your dental expert will assist you make the very best option for your needs.

Next, talk about any medicines you're currently taking with your dental practitioner ahead of time. This includes over-the-counter medicines and supplements, as they may influence your sedation choices.

If you're having sedation dental care, your dental professional will likely offer details guidelines. You might require to refrain from consuming or consuming alcohol for a specific duration prior to your visit. Comply with these standards closely to ensure your security.

Schedule someone to accompany you on the day of your consultation, specifically if you'll be receiving sedation. You will not have the ability to drive afterward, so having actually a trusted close friend or relative to help you is vital.

Finally, prepare any kind of questions you have in development. This is your possibility to make clear any type of problems concerning the procedure, sedation choices, or recovery.
